Quantitative Changes of Some Related Bacteria Species in the Rumenof Dairy Goatssuffered from Subacute Rumen Acidosis

Abstract: The quantitative changes of some related bacteria in the rumen of dairy goats suffered from subacute rumen acidosis (SARA) were determined. Six Guanzhong lactating goats with similar weights and fixed with ruminal cannula were used.They were fed concentrates daily by gradually increasing feeding regime. The trial was divided into four stages and in first stage dietary concentrate-to-forage ratio is 5∶5, in second stage 6∶4, in third stage 7∶3,and in the fourth stage 8∶2. The amount of ruminal bacteria of the experimental animals were determined by the method of 16S rRNA probes and traditional cultivation method. With the increase of the dietary concentrate to forage ratio, the quantities of Strepococcus bovis, Lactobacillus, Selenomonas ruminantium, Megasphera elsdenii and Amylolytic bacteria were increased in varying degrees, while amounts of the three kinds Cellulolytic bacterias were decreased and the numbers of amylolytic bacteria increased significantly(P<0.01).Under the condition suffered from SARA, the amounts of rumen bacteria, Lactate-production bacteria and Lactate-utilizing bacteria were all increased, and quantities of the three main kinds Cellulolytic bacterias were decreased significantly.
